In recent years, the world of sports has evolved beyond just games and entertainment. It has become a significant driver of economic growth, creating employment opportunities and impacting job markets globally. The sports industry encompasses a wide range of professions, from athletes and coaches to marketers and event organizers, contributing to the creation of a diverse and dynamic job market. One of the primary ways sports influences employment is through the direct hiring of individuals to work within the industry. Athletes, coaches, trainers, and support staff form the backbone of sports organizations, requiring a range of skills and expertise. Additionally, sports teams and organizations often employ professionals in areas such as marketing, finance, and operations to support their activities. These roles not only provide job opportunities but also contribute to the overall growth of the sports industry. Moreover, the influence of sports extends beyond just the teams and organizations themselves. The sports industry has a ripple effect on related sectors such as tourism, hospitality, and media, creating additional job opportunities. Major sporting events like the Olympics, World Cup, and Super Bowl attract tourists, leading to increased demand for services such as accommodation, transportation, and entertainment. This surge in activity not only boosts local economies but also creates temporary and permanent employment opportunities for individuals in various sectors. Furthermore, the rise of digital technologies has revolutionized the way sports are consumed, leading to the emergence of new job roles within the industry. Careers in sports analytics, social media management, and esports have become increasingly popular, reflecting the evolving nature of the sports job market. The demand for professionals with digital skills and expertise has opened up new avenues for individuals looking to pursue a career in sports. In conclusion, the impact of sports on employment and the job market is significant and multifaceted. From direct employment opportunities within sports organizations to indirect job creation in related sectors, the sports industry plays a crucial role in driving economic growth and providing diverse career paths for individuals.
